Key Takeaways

  • Gabapentin works by blocking voltage-gated calcium channels in nerve cells, specifically targeting neuropathic pain rather than the prostaglandins and cytokines that drive inflammatory responses.

  • Standard anti-inflammatory drugs like ibuprofen (200-800mg) or naproxen reduce swelling within 1-2 hours by inhibiting COX enzymes, while gabapentin typically takes 1-3 weeks to show effects on nerve pain.

  • Secondary neuropathic pain can develop when chronic conditions like rheumatoid arthritis or injury damage surrounding nerves, creating burning or shooting sensations distinct from inflammatory aching.

  • Combination therapy may be necessary, with NSAIDs for acute tissue swelling and gabapentin (starting at 300mg daily) for any nerve hypersensitivity that develops alongside the original injury.

  • Distinguishing inflammatory pain (worse with movement, responds to ice or heat) from neuropathic pain (burning, tingling, often worse at night) determines which medication class will be most effective.

Gabapentin is not an anti-inflammatory drug. It does not reduce swelling, redness, or the immune response behind inflammation. It targets nerve pain by calming overactive nerve signals, which means it can help when inflammation triggers nerve sensitivity, but it won't address the inflammation itself. What Is Gabapentin and How Does It Work?

Gabapentin’s Primary Uses

Gabapentin is a prescription drug mainly used to treat nerve-related conditions. Doctors often prescribe it for epilepsy, nerve pain caused by shingles, or diabetic nerve damage. It works by calming nerve activity in the brain and nervous system, which helps reduce pain signals and seizures. In addition to these primary uses, gabapentin is sometimes utilized off-label for conditions such as restless leg syndrome, anxiety disorders, and even certain types of chronic pain syndromes. Its versatility makes it a valuable option in the pain management arsenal, particularly for patients who may not respond well to traditional pain medications.

How Gabapentin Affects the Body

Gabapentin changes how nerves send messages to the brain. It does not directly attack pain or inflammation like some other medications. Instead, it helps the nervous system feel less sensitive. This means that while it can reduce pain caused by nerve damage, it does not target the root cause of inflammation. The drug binds to specific sites on voltage-gated calcium channels in the central nervous system, which ultimately decreases the release of excitatory neurotransmitters. This mechanism is particularly beneficial for individuals suffering from neuropathic pain, as it can provide relief where other pain relievers may fall short. Furthermore, gabapentin is generally well-tolerated, with a side effect profile that includes dizziness and fatigue, making it a preferable option for many patients.

Inflammation Explained: What Happens in Your Body?

What Is Inflammation?

Inflammation is your body’s natural response to injury or infection. When you get hurt or sick, your immune system sends extra blood and cells to the affected area. This causes swelling, redness, heat, and sometimes pain. Inflammation helps protect and heal your body, but if it lasts too long, it can cause problems. The process involves a complex interplay of various immune cells, signaling molecules, and blood vessels that work together to isolate and eliminate harmful agents, such as pathogens or damaged cells. This intricate response is crucial for initiating the healing process and restoring normal function to the affected tissues.

However, while acute inflammation is essential for recovery, chronic inflammation can lead to a variety of health issues. Factors such as poor diet, lack of exercise, and stress can contribute to the persistence of inflammation in the body. For instance, a diet high in processed foods and sugars can promote inflammatory pathways, while regular physical activity can help reduce inflammation levels. Understanding the balance between these two types of inflammation is vital for maintaining overall health and preventing chronic diseases.

Types of Inflammation

  • Acute Inflammation: Short-term and helpful, like when you get a cut or bruise.

  • Chronic Inflammation: Long-lasting and harmful, linked to diseases like arthritis, heart disease, and diabetes.

Acute inflammation typically resolves once the underlying cause is addressed, allowing the body to return to its normal state. Symptoms may include localized pain and swelling, which serve as signals that something is wrong. In contrast, chronic inflammation can be insidious, often developing silently over time and manifesting as fatigue, fever, or even digestive issues. This prolonged state of inflammation can lead to tissue damage and is increasingly being recognized as a key player in the development of various chronic conditions, making it essential to identify and address the root causes of inflammation in our lives.

Does Gabapentin Help with Inflammation?

What Science Says About Gabapentin and Inflammation

Gabapentin is not classified as an anti-inflammatory drug. It does not reduce swelling or inflammation directly. Instead, it focuses on calming nerve pain, which can sometimes feel like inflammation. For example, if nerve irritation causes pain after an injury, gabapentin may help reduce the pain sensation without actually lowering the swelling. Researchers have found no meaningful evidence that gabapentin inhibits prostaglandins, cytokines, or other key drivers of the inflammatory response the way NSAIDs do.

When Gabapentin Might Be Helpful

Gabapentin can be useful when inflammation causes nerve pain or sensitivity. Conditions like neuropathy or postherpetic neuralgia involve nerve damage and pain, and gabapentin can ease these symptoms. However, if you have inflammation without nerve pain, gabapentin is unlikely to help with the swelling or redness itself.

Is Gabapentin an Anti-Inflammatory? Breaking Down the Difference

This is one of the most common questions people ask about gabapentin, and the short answer is no. Gabapentin is an anticonvulsant and neuropathic pain agent, not an anti-inflammatory medication.

Anti-inflammatory drugs work by blocking specific chemical pathways. NSAIDs like ibuprofen (200-800mg) inhibit COX enzymes, which lowers the production of prostaglandins, the signaling molecules that trigger swelling, heat, and redness at an injury or infection site. They start reducing inflammation within one to two hours. Corticosteroids like prednisone suppress the immune response more broadly, cutting off the cytokines and immune cells that sustain chronic inflammation.

Gabapentin does none of that. It binds to voltage-gated calcium channels in the central nervous system and reduces the release of excitatory neurotransmitters like glutamate, substance P, and norepinephrine. The result is a quieter, less reactive nervous system. Pain signals still reach the brain, but the nerves amplify them less. That is why gabapentin typically takes one to three weeks to show a meaningful effect on nerve pain, compared to the near-immediate relief an NSAID provides for a swollen joint.

So why does gabapentin sometimes help with inflammatory conditions?

When tissue is inflamed for a long time, the nerves in and around that tissue can become sensitized. This is called secondary neuropathic pain, and it is common in conditions like rheumatoid arthritis, chronic back pain, and post-surgical recovery. Patients often describe it as a burning, electric, or shooting sensation layered on top of the usual aching.

In those cases, gabapentin can reduce the neuropathic component of the pain even though it leaves the underlying inflammation untouched. A doctor might prescribe an NSAID to control the swelling and gabapentin alongside it to manage nerve hypersensitivity. These two drug classes do not duplicate each other.

How to tell which type of pain you have

Inflammatory pain tends to be worse with movement, concentrated around a joint or wound site, and it usually responds to ice, heat, or an NSAID within a few hours. Neuropathic pain feels different: burning, tingling, electric-shock sensations, or pain that is worse at night. It often does not respond well to standard pain relievers.

Other Medications That Target Inflammation

Common Anti-Inflammatory Drugs

If inflammation is your main concern, there are better options than gabapentin. Nonsteroidal anti-inflammatory drugs (NSAIDs) like ibuprofen and naproxen reduce swelling and pain by blocking chemicals that cause inflammation. Steroids like prednisone are stronger and used for serious inflammation, but come with more side effects.

When to Use Anti-Inflammatory Medications

These medications are often recommended for injuries, arthritis, or inflammatory diseases. They work by directly lowering the immune response that causes swelling. If your doctor suspects inflammation is causing your symptoms, they may suggest one of these drugs instead of gabapentin.

No, gabapentin is not an anti-inflammatory drug. It is an anticonvulsant that also treats neuropathic pain by reducing overactive nerve signaling. It does not block COX enzymes, lower prostaglandin levels, or suppress the immune response the way NSAIDs or corticosteroids do.

Gabapentin does not reduce swelling. Swelling is caused by increased blood flow and immune cell activity at an injury or infection site, and gabapentin does not affect those processes. If swelling is your main concern, an NSAID like ibuprofen or naproxen is a more appropriate choice.

A doctor may add gabapentin to a treatment plan when chronic inflammation has caused secondary nerve damage or sensitization. For example, people with rheumatoid arthritis or chronic back pain sometimes develop a burning, shooting nerve pain on top of their inflammatory pain. In those cases, gabapentin targets the nerve component while an anti-inflammatory drug addresses the swelling.

Inflammatory pain is usually aching or throbbing, concentrated near a swollen joint or wound, and responds to ice, heat, or NSAIDs within hours. Neuropathic pain feels more like burning, tingling, or electric shocks, is often worse at night, and responds poorly to standard pain relievers. Identifying which type you have helps your doctor choose the right medication.

In many cases, yes. Gabapentin and ibuprofen work through completely different mechanisms, so they can complement each other when both neuropathic and inflammatory pain are present. However, you should always check with a doctor before combining medications, since individual health conditions and other drugs you take can affect safety.
